How an Eccentric Plug Valve Works?
Closed Position: Plug rotates into seat position to provide full seal without interruption with tight seal formation against flow path.
Opening Process: With rotation of the stem, the eccentric shape of the plug allows it to lift up from the seat with no rubbing contact between the plug and seat faces.
Open Position: In open position, the plug is rotated away from the flow path to give unimpeded bore with reduced pressure drop.
Sealing Feature: Minimal rubbing of the plug against the seat reduces wear and minimizes chances of sticking and galling.
This lift and rotate action is what separates eccentric plug valves from ball valves and standard plug valves, it reduces friction related wear while still delivering tight, bubble tight shutoff.
Key Design Features:
Cam action, non rubbing plug rotation
Field adjustable packing gland for stem sealing
Corrosion resistant trim options, including elastomer coated and metal seated plugs
Full port and reduced port configurations
Suitable for on/off isolation and, in select designs, throttling and modulating service
Compact, low torque operation compatible with manual levers, gearboxes, or actuators

Industry and Applications of Eccentric Plug valve:
Industry | Applications |
Oil and Gas | Wellhead isolation, gathering lines, produced water handling, pipeline pigging systems, tank farm isolation |
Municipal Water and Wastewater | Raw water intake control, sludge and biosolids handling, digester gas lines, lift station isolation, filter backwash control |
Chemical and Petrochemical | Corrosive fluid transfer, reactor feed isolation, batch process control, tank drain and loading lines |
Power Generation | Ash and slurry handling, cooling water systems, flue gas desulfurization (FGD) lines, boiler blowdown isolation |
Mining and Mineral Processing | Tailings transport, slurry pipelines, thickener underflow control, abrasive ore-processing streams |
Pulp and Paper | Stock and pulp stream isolation, black liquor handling, white water recirculation, chemical dosing lines |
Marine and Shipbuilding | Ballast water systems, bilge and sludge handling, seawater intake isolation |
